## npm
|
||||
|
||||
This project does not publish an official [npm](https://www.npmjs.com) package. The npm package
|
||||
[`nlohmann-json`](https://www.npmjs.com/package/nlohmann-json) (or similarly named packages) is not maintained or
|
||||
endorsed by this project. Use one of the package managers listed above, or integrate the single header directly.

/*!
|
||||
@brief Validate a BSON document's declared size against the bytes read.
|
||||
|
||||
A BSON document starts with an int32 that counts its own total length in
|
||||
bytes, including that prefix and the trailing 0x00. The reader is driven
|
||||
by the terminator rather than the declared length, so without this check a
|
||||
nested document could declare a length that disagrees with where its
|
||||
terminator actually falls and quietly hand the bytes in between to the
|
||||
enclosing document. A well-formed document is at least 5 bytes (the prefix
|
||||
plus the terminator); the equality also rejects those impossible sizes,
|
||||
since at least 5 bytes are always consumed.
|
||||
|
||||
@param[in] document_start value of chars_read before the size prefix
|
||||
@param[in] document_size the declared document size
|
||||
@return whether the declared size matches the number of bytes read
|
||||
*/
|
||||
bool check_bson_document_size(const std::size_t document_start, const std::int32_t document_size)
|
||||
{
|
||||
if (JSON_HEDLEY_UNLIKELY(document_size < 0 || static_cast<std::size_t>(document_size) != chars_read - document_start))
|
||||
{
|
||||
return sax->parse_error(chars_read, get_token_string(), parse_error::create(112, chars_read,
|
||||
exception_message(input_format_t::bson, concat("document size ", std::to_string(document_size), " does not match the number of bytes read (", std::to_string(chars_read - document_start), ")"), "document"), nullptr));
|
||||
}
|
||||
return true;
|
||||
}

TEST_CASE("BSON document size mismatch")
|
||||
{
|
||||
json _;
|
||||
|
||||
SECTION("top-level document declaring more bytes than it contains")
|
||||
{
|
||||
// empty object, but the length prefix claims 6 bytes instead of 5
|
||||
std::vector<std::uint8_t> const input = {0x06, 0x00, 0x00, 0x00, 0x00};
|
||||
CHECK_THROWS_WITH_AS(_ = json::from_bson(input), "[json.exception.parse_error.112] parse error at byte 5: syntax error while parsing BSON document: document size 6 does not match the number of bytes read (5)", json::parse_error&);
|
||||
CHECK(json::from_bson(input, true, false).is_discarded());
|
||||
}
|
||||
|
||||
SECTION("top-level document with a negative size")
|
||||
{
|
||||
std::vector<std::uint8_t> const input = {0xFF, 0xFF, 0xFF, 0xFF, 0x00};
|
||||
CHECK_THROWS_WITH_AS(_ = json::from_bson(input), "[json.exception.parse_error.112] parse error at byte 5: syntax error while parsing BSON document: document size -1 does not match the number of bytes read (5)", json::parse_error&);
|
||||
CHECK(json::from_bson(input, true, false).is_discarded());
|
||||
}
|
||||
|
||||
SECTION("embedded document whose size disagrees with its terminator")
|
||||
{
|
||||
// the embedded document "d" declares 0x7FFFFFFF bytes but its 0x00
|
||||
// terminator falls right after {"a":null}; the length prefix would
|
||||
// otherwise let the following "h" element be read as a member of the
|
||||
// enclosing document instead of "d"
|
||||
std::vector<std::uint8_t> const input =
|
||||
{
|
||||
0x00, 0x00, 0x00, 0x00, // outer size
|
||||
0x03, 'd', 0x00, // entry: embedded document "d"
|
||||
0xFF, 0xFF, 0xFF, 0x7F, // embedded size 0x7FFFFFFF
|
||||
0x0A, 'a', 0x00, // entry: null "a"
|
||||
0x00, // embedded end marker
|
||||
0x08, 'h', 0x00, 0x01, // entry: bool "h" = true
|
||||
0x00 // outer end marker
|
||||
};
|
||||
CHECK_THROWS_WITH_AS(_ = json::from_bson(input), "[json.exception.parse_error.112] parse error at byte 15: syntax error while parsing BSON document: document size 2147483647 does not match the number of bytes read (8)", json::parse_error&);
|
||||
CHECK(json::from_bson(input, true, false).is_discarded());
|
||||
}
|
||||
|
||||
SECTION("embedded array whose size disagrees with its terminator")
|
||||
{
|
||||
// array [42] is 12 bytes, but the length prefix claims 13
|
||||
std::vector<std::uint8_t> const input =
|
||||
{
|
||||
0x00, 0x00, 0x00, 0x00, // outer size
|
||||
0x04, 'a', 0x00, // entry: array "a"
|
||||
0x0D, 0x00, 0x00, 0x00, // array size 13 (real is 12)
|
||||
0x10, '0', 0x00, 0x2A, 0x00, 0x00, 0x00, // entry: int32 "0" = 42
|
||||
0x00, // array end marker
|
||||
0x00 // outer end marker
|
||||
};
|
||||
CHECK_THROWS_WITH_AS(_ = json::from_bson(input), "[json.exception.parse_error.112] parse error at byte 19: syntax error while parsing BSON document: document size 13 does not match the number of bytes read (12)", json::parse_error&);
|
||||
CHECK(json::from_bson(input, true, false).is_discarded());
|
||||
}
|
||||
}
